What Professional Gate Repair in Newark Covers
Every property has different access demands, and professional service adapts to the gate style, usage level, and security goals. For homes across the North and South Wards, residential gate repair Newark typically focuses on swing or slide driveway gates that blend security with aesthetics. Common issues include sagging hinges, bent posts, cracked welds, worn rollers, misaligned tracks, and sensor malfunctions. In multi-family buildings and HOAs, technicians often address intercom glitches, keypad failures, and photo-eye misalignment that cause nuisance stoppages or unsafe closures.
On the commercial side, commercial gate repair Newark spans heavy-duty sliding, cantilever, and bi-fold systems that must withstand constant cycles and harsh conditions near the port and industrial corridors. Problems can involve chain and sprocket wear, gearbox noise, seized bearings, track damage from forklifts or trucks, and control board failures. Salt, road debris, and winter freeze-thaw cycles accelerate corrosion, making galvanized and powder-coated finishes, stainless hardware, and proper drainage essential to long-term reliability. Service pros inspect for structural integrity, re-tension chains, re-level tracks, replace roller assemblies, and correct weld fractures to return gates to full duty.
Automation is the lifeblood of modern access control in Newark. That’s why automatic gate repair Newark and driveway gate repair Newark frequently include operator tuning, sensor calibration, and loop detector diagnostics. Technicians test motor amperage, limit switches, and clutch settings, recalibrate for seasonal temperature shifts, and upgrade worn components before they fail. For emergency gate repair Newark, priority is clearing obstructions, safely bypassing the operator for manual operation, and restoring secure closure. Whether it’s a private residence off Bloomfield Avenue or a distribution hub near Newark Liberty International Airport, the goal is the same: fast, safe, standards-compliant repairs that keep access smooth and secure.
From Diagnosis to Same-Day Fix: Process, Safety, and Technology
An effective service visit starts with precise diagnosis. Crews arrive equipped to troubleshoot electrical, mechanical, and structural systems in one pass, minimizing downtime. After verifying power and safety lockout, they perform a step-by-step evaluation: inspect hinges, posts, rollers, tracks, operator mounts, belts or chains, and wiring harnesses; test photo-eyes, edge sensors, and loop detectors; and scan control panels for error codes. For same day gate repair Newark, trucks carry common parts—rollers, hinges, brackets, sensors, belts, chains, control boards, and remotes—so most issues can be resolved on the spot.
Safety is non-negotiable. Professional repairs follow UL 325 and ASTM F2200 guidelines for automated gates to prevent entrapment and ensure proper force settings, guard clearances, and sensor coverage. This is crucial for schools, logistics yards, and multi-tenant properties where high traffic and liability intersect. Technicians verify that photo-eyes are aligned and free of debris, edge sensors are responsive, manual release mechanisms function smoothly, and the operator’s force profile is within spec. If needed, they recommend upgrades such as monitored safety devices, battery backup for power outages, and surge protection against lightning and grid fluctuations—critical in storm-prone seasons.
Technology keeps evolving, and Newark properties benefit from modern access control integrations. Keypads, RFID tags, intercoms with video, and smartphone-based entry streamline operations while preserving audit trails. During driveway gate repair Newark or commercial service, crews can program remotes, update controller firmware, and synchronize timers with business hours to reduce nuisance lockouts. When timelines are tight, electric gate repair Newark ensures operators, sensors, and access systems work together seamlessly, restoring automation without sacrificing safety. For property managers searching “gate repair near me Newark,” responsiveness matters: dispatch times, real-time status updates, and transparent estimates keep budgets predictable. After the fix, a concise maintenance plan—lubrication schedules, periodic force testing, corrosion checks, and firmware updates—helps prevent repeat failures and extends equipment life.
Case Studies Around Newark: Real Repairs, Real Results
Ironbound Restaurant, Sliding Gate Jam: A bustling restaurant in the Ironbound district relies on a sliding steel gate to secure its delivery alley. Winter salt and slush had accumulated in the track, corroding the roller bearings and causing the operator to stall. The technician arrived for emergency gate repair Newark within hours, safely disengaged the operator, and restored manual movement to clear deliveries. After flushing the track and replacing the roller assemblies, they recalibrated the operator’s force limits and mounted a track shield to reduce debris intrusion. The crew also added a corrosion-resistant roller kit and scheduled quarterly cleaning—preventing future jams during peak dinner service.
Forest Hill Home, Swing Gate Motor Failure: A homeowner reported intermittent operation and grinding noise from a decade-old swing gate motor. The consult for residential gate repair Newark revealed a worn output shaft and misaligned hinge causing binding in cold weather. The solution included a new brushless DC operator with soft-start/soft-stop, fresh hinge pins and bushings, and a reinforced post base. Photo-eyes were elevated to avoid snow drift blockage, and a battery backup module safeguarded access during outages. The final step was optimizing force settings and teaching the controller new limits, ensuring gentle, quiet movement that complements the property’s aesthetics while meeting modern safety standards.
Port-Area Warehouse, Cantilever Gate Impact: A forklift accidentally struck the tail end of a cantilever gate at an industrial facility near Port Newark. The gate sagged, scraping the receiver post and triggering safety reversals that halted operations. Responding under a same day gate repair Newark call, the team conducted a structural assessment, cold-straightened a bent frame member, replaced damaged guide rollers, and re-leveled the carriage tubes. The operator chain was re-tensioned, sprockets aligned, and the control board’s amperage thresholds reset. For long-term resilience, the facility approved heavier-duty rollers with sealed bearings and a high-build zinc-rich coating to resist coastal corrosion—typical best practices in commercial gate repair Newark for high-cycle environments.
University Heights Multi-Unit Property, Intermittent Access Control: Residents experienced random gate refusals during rain. Investigation during an automatic gate repair Newark service visit found water ingress in a junction box and a failing loop detector card. Technicians replaced the card, re-sealed conduit entries, rerouted low-voltage wires away from mains to reduce interference, and installed a drip loop. They also upgraded to monitored photo-eyes, ensuring the system fails safe if a sensor is compromised. As part of preventive maintenance, the property manager received a seasonal checklist: clean lenses, test edges, verify battery health, and inspect surge suppression—practical steps that reduce outages when weather turns.
South Ward Driveway, Track Frost Heave: A residential sliding gate began rubbing after repeated freeze-thaw cycles lifted a section of track. For this gate repair Newark scenario, the team removed the affected track section, re-compacted the substrate with proper drainage, and reinstalled using corrosion-resistant anchors. They swapped in a larger diameter V-groove wheel to better tolerate minor ground shifts and lubricated with a cold-weather-grade product. The operator’s travel curve was re-taught, and a reminder was set for spring inspection. This illustrates how local climate realities shape driveway gate repair Newark strategies as much as mechanics do, and why seasonal tune-ups save money across Newark’s varied neighborhoods.
